Here is the response from Lucas Oil regarding the Bob the Oil site.
Ron,
Thanks for your interest in Lucas Oil Products. This demonstration in
no way replicates the actual environment of an engine, transmission or
differential. Our original demonstrator that you find in stores is
designed to highlight the increased surface tension our Heavy Duty Oil
Stabilizer brings to your common oil. It increases it to the point that
it will climb gears. In doing this it folds air into itself and looks a
lot like taffy being pulled and twisted. You will even see bubbles in
the base of our demonstrator as it is gathered and pulled around the
gears. This product works and that's the bottom line. It gives you
added lubricity and stronger surface tension. This combination enables
truckers to go 1 million miles plus without any major engine repairs and
even at that point technicians report that bearing wear is negligible.
If you want to learn more go to our website, www.lucasoil.com, and see what our customers have to say about the product line.
